同款商品多尺码并可订购不同数量如何设置?

2016-07-07 15:14 来源:www.chinab4c.com 作者:ecshop专家

我们做的是一个服装批发网站,想让客户可以订购同款服装可以不同的尺寸,不同的尺寸可以订购不同的数量。

比如:一件服装有 S X L XL 四个尺码,客人想S 下 10件 X下 20件 L 下30件 XL 下40件(不同尺码的价格都是一样的)

我们现在安装了以后,只能选择一个总体的数量具体每个尺码多少件没法输入。

希望能够指导下如何使用安装!!!

谢谢了!

回答:
你可以设置商品属性。但目前也还是不可以做到像你所说的

现在一次不能顶多个规格的商品,如果需要,建议分次订。
或者在定点附言中写明

原来我不经意发现的一个问题,竟然是现在还难以技术上解决的问题。

希望ECSHOP能够尽快解决这个问题哦!呵呵

这个是我们购物流程的原因,这个不好更改,如果没有大的变动,这个暂时不会更改。
我们会收集,您的意见和建议,会在以后的购物流程中加以优化。

不牵涉到价格变动,用附言说明已经足够了。

先在goods.php最后写查询商品信息与属性信息与品牌信息
/*相同产品不同型号信息列表*/
function get_goods_name_list($goods_id)
{
$sql="SELECT g.*, at.*,b.brand_name,g.shop_price + at.attr_price as price FROM ". $GLOBALS['ecs']->table('goods') ." as g " .
"LEFT JOIN " . $GLOBALS['ecs']->table('brand') . " AS b ON g.brand_id = b.brand_id " .
"LEFT JOIN " . $GLOBALS['ecs']->table('goods_attr') . " AS at ON at.goods_id = g.goods_id " .
" WHERE g.goods_id = '$goods_id' order by at.attr_price asc";
$goods_name_list = $GLOBALS['db']->getAll($sql);
if ($goods_name_list['goods_id'] > 0)
{
$goods_name_list['url'] = build_uri('goods', array('gid'=>$goods_name_list['goods_id']), $goods_name_list['goods_name']);
}
if ($goods_name_list['brand_id'] > 0)
{
$goods_name_list['goods_brand_url'] = build_uri('brand', array('bid'=>$goods_name_list['brand_id']), $goods_name_list['goods_brand']);
}

return $goods_name_list;

}

9#有个地方发错了,是otable,我写成了oform了,不好意思。另外在后台加型号属性才可以